snake, serpent, hard drinker
Kun:
へび
On:
ジャ
Jōyō kanji, taught in junior high
JLPT level N1
1721 of 2500 most used kanji in newspapers

Speed

Stroke order

On reading compounds

  • 蛇 【ヘビ】 snake, serpent, large snake
  • 蛇口 【ジャグチ】 faucet, tap
  • 王蛇 【オウジャ】 boa (snake)
  • 長蛇 【チョウダ】 long snake, long line (of people, etc.)
  • 蛇行 【ダコウ】 meandering, snaking, zigzagging
  • 蛇蠍 【ダカツ】 serpent (snake) and scorpion, detestation
  • 委蛇 【イイ】 winding, meandering
  • 游蛇 【ユウダ】 water snake
  • 委蛇 【イイ】 winding, meandering

Kun reading compounds

  • 蛇 【へび】 snake, serpent, large snake
  • 蛇穴に入る 【へびあなにいる】 snake hibernation
  • 裸蛇 【はだかへび】 caecilian (any burrowing legless amphibian of the order Gymnophiona)
  • 錦蛇 【にしきへび】 python, rock snake

blame, condemn, censure
Kun:
せ.める
On:
セキ
Jōyō kanji, taught in grade 5
JLPT level N3
598 of 2500 most used kanji in newspapers

Speed

Stroke order

On reading compounds

  • 責 【セキ】 responsibility, duty, obligation
  • 責任 【セキニン】 duty, responsibility (incl. supervision of staff), liability, onus
  • 問責 【モンセキ】 blame, censure, reproof, reprimand, rebuke
  • 引責 【インセキ】 taking responsibility

Kun reading compounds

  • 責める 【せめる】 to condemn, to blame, to criticize, to criticise, to reproach, to accuse, to urge, to press, to pester, to torture, to torment, to persecute, to break in (a horse)
